About this tour

Skip the queues at Florence's Accademia Gallery with a private guide who knows Renaissance art inside out. You'll have the gallery largely to yourself for an hour, moving through the collection at your own rhythm with expert commentary on Michelangelo's David and the surrounding masterpieces. Your guide tailors the experience to what genuinely interests your group—whether that's technique, history, or cultural context—rather than rushing through a standard script.

What to expect

You'll meet your guide at the agreed point and head straight in through reserved entry. For the next hour, they'll walk you through the collection, starting with context-setting pieces before reaching David. Expect them to pause where your group shows genuine curiosity—asking questions prompts richer discussion rather than a one-way lecture. The guide reads the room: art students get technical detail, families get accessible narratives, first-timers get the big-picture story. Crowds thin noticeably when you're moving as a private group.

Good to know

The gallery is accessible for wheelchairs and pushchairs. Public transport is nearby if you're getting to the meeting point. Wear comfortable shoes—an hour on marble floors adds up. Bring questions; guides respond better to genuine curiosity than silence.
